文章目录前言一、生成树协议?二、生成树原理1.STP工作原理2.STP主要参数3.STP根网桥4.STP协议版本三、生成树实验1.配置步骤2.配置3.配置结果3.ping四、总结前言提示:个人理解为抑制网络广播风暴提示:以下是本篇文章正文内容,下面案例可供参考一、生成树协议?生成树协议STP(SpanningTreeProtocol)是工作在OSI网络模型中的第二层(数据链路层)的通信协议,基本应用是防止交换机冗余链路产生的环路。用于确保以太网中无环路的逻辑拓扑结构,从而避免了广播风暴,大量占用交换机的资源。二、生成树原理1.STP工作原理任意一交换机中如果到达根网桥有两条或者两条以上的链路,
目录Windows环境下利用FreeNAS组建IP-SAN实验报告一、【实验目的】二、【实验设备】三、【实验要求】四、【实验步骤】子任务一:FreeNAS网络设置子任务二:FreeNAS硬盘设置子任务三:组建RAID5子任务四:配置iSCSI服务子任务五:测试 ps:加上密码验证五、【实验总结】Windows环境下利用FreeNAS组建IP-SAN实验报告一、【实验目的】学会利用FreeNAS组建IP-SAN网络,理解掌握IP-SAN的工作原理。二、【实验设备】FreeNas三、【实验要求】学会利用FreeNAS组建IP-SAN网络,理解掌握IP-SAN的工作原理。四、【实验步骤】子任务一:F
实验5-1验证性实验——两级阻容耦合负反馈放大器实验参照下图连接电路,在放大器输入端加入Uim=10mV,f=1kHzU_{im}=10mV,f=1kHzUim=10mV,f=1kHz的正弦信号,并确认电路连接无误测量静态工作点令ui=0u_i=0ui=0,接通电源,根据下表中的参数对电路直流工作点进行测量,将结果记入表中,并与仿真结果进行比较(估算值依旧取β=100,rbb′=300Ω,UBE(on)=0.7V\beta=100,r_{bb'}=300\Omega,U_{BE(on)}=0.7Vβ=100,rbb′=300Ω,UBE(on)=0.7V)UC1/VU_{C1}/VUC1
实验过程(包含实验结果)下载安装WinPcap安装成功下载开发包并解压添加新库目录预处理器添加WPCAP和HAVE_REMOTE这两个宏定义添加两个库测试,获取与网络适配器绑定的设备列表测试代码见(VS2019配置WinPcap开发)ARP欺骗工具编写流程:选择设备并打开,用于捕获数据包;构造ARP数据包;发送编写代码需要的库函数获取设备列表,并打印选取一个设备用于捕获数据包打开设备伪造ARPreply包发送使用wireshark抓包查看效果测试环境目标主机:IP:192.168.243.80MAC:00-0C-29-B0-D7-94目标主机网关:IP:192.168.243.33MAC:92
年级班号 组号 学号专业日期 姓名实验名称实验二、地址解析协议ARP实验室实验目的或要求了解PacketTracer软件的安装方法,掌握软件使用方法;掌握ARP协议地址解析原理和过程实验环境PC机1台,PacketTracer软件一套实验内容1.安装软件PacketTracer;2.使用PacketTracer搭建网络,仿真ARP协议工作过程并分析实验步骤(1)发送方是主机,要把IP数据报发送到本网络上的另一个主机。这时用ARP找到目的主机的硬件地址。1)构建图2)配置IP地址3)目的Mac地址不知道4)PC5发ARP包PC6返回ARP包(携带MAC地址)5)PC5发完整的PC6返回确认(2)
1.目标:键盘输入一个字符'a',串口工具显示'b'; 键盘输入一个字符串"nihao",串口工具显示"nihao";2.框图分析: 3.代码:---.h头文件---#ifndef__UART4_H__#define__UART4_H__#include"stm32mp1xx_rcc.h"#include"stm32mp1xx_gpio.h"#include"stm32mp1xx_uart.h"//RCC/GPIO/UART4章节初始化voidhal_uart4_init();//发送一个字符函数voidhal_put_char(constcharstr);//发送一个字符串函数v
介绍ab分流的流量保护功能之前,先普及一下ab分流的一些概念和术语名词解释:实验:用来验证某个决定请求处理方式的功能或策略的一部分流量,通常用来验证某个功能或策略对系统指标(如PV/UV,CRT,下单转化率等)的影响。流量 :指所有访问用户的请求Hash因子:可以理解为访问实验用户的uuid,即一个可以识别某个流量用户的唯一标识。Hash算法:是把任意长度的输入通过散列算法变换成固定长度的输出,是一种从任意文件中创造小的数字「指纹」的方法。与指纹一样,散列算法就是一种以较短的信息来保证文件唯一性的标志桶位:ab测试又称为分桶测试。当用户的请求打到某个实验进行分流时,分流引擎会根据请求的uuid
实验四 Oracle数据库安全管理一、实验目的(1)掌握Oracle数据库安全控制的实现。(2)掌握Oracle数据库用户管理。(3)掌握Oracle数据库权限管理。(4)掌握Oracle数据库角色管理。(5)了解Oracle数据库概要文件的管理。(6)了解Oracle数据库审计。二、实验要求(1)为ORCL数据库创建用户。(2)为ORCL数据库用户进行权限授予与回收(3)为ORCL数据库创建角色,利用角色为用户授权。(4)为ORCL数据库创建概要文件,并指定给用户。(5)对ORCL数据库中的用户操作进行审计。三、实验内容(1)创建一个名为Tom的用户,采用口令认证方式,口令为Tom,默认表空
组合数据类型(列表、元组、字典)一二三四五六七一构造一个person的列表结构list1,元素为参加调查问卷的人员的名字(不用太多),(建立列表有很多方法,选择一种你喜欢的),命名为3.1.py从键盘上输入一个人名,判断这个人名是否在list1中。(1)如果人名在列表中,就输出“您已经参与过调查,感谢参与!!!”。(2)如果人名不在列表中,输出“您是否已经参加过?是/否”1)如果用户选择“是”,将用户名字加入list1末尾,输出“抱歉,我们统计有误!,感谢参与!!!”2)如果用户选择否,输出“,希望您能参与调查”图示范例结果为:list1=['周杰伦','超级玛丽','李云迪','乔丹','马
我正在尝试将native预构建共享库添加到我在AndroidStudio中的项目。我正在使用gradle-experimental:0.6.0-alpha5。但是,每当我尝试将预构建的共享库添加到我的应用程序模型时,我都会收到以下错误:Error:Cause:org.gradle.api.internal.PolymorphicDomainObjectContainerConfigureDelegate库被添加到应用程序模型中,它是如何被GoogleGradleExperimentalGuide描述的:repositories{prebuilt(PrebuiltLibraries){b